## Step 7: Cut over the PointsBook ledger

Before switching writes to the new PointsBook loyalty-points ledger, verify that the backfill job has reached parity and that balance checksums match on both stores. Future maintainers should keep the old ledger read-only for thirty days. Once parity is confirmed, apply the following configuration values to the ledger service.

service settings:
PRAIX_LOG_LEVEL=error
PRAIX_METRICS_HOST=metrics.praix.qorvelcorp.corp
PRAIX_POOL_SIZE=16

Subject: Handover — Pellfield admin

Hey Tomas,

Quick handover before I'm out. The bulk-edit feature in the Pellfield admin table shipped Friday; if rows lock mid-edit, kick the worker pool, don't restart the whole service. Everything else is green. You'll need to sign tonight's hotfix bundle yourself, so here's the deploy key we use for that.

signing key of bagap-yawep = bky13_TbfT6ZMUoGJo2

Severity: High. New candidates on the Vigilum platform occasionally remain in the pending state even after a proctor accepts the session. The queue consumer acknowledges the message but never writes the assignment row, so the UI keeps polling forever. Reproduced twice on the staging cluster under load; suspect a race between the accept handler and the session-expiry sweeper. Workaround: manually requeue via the admin panel. The affected builds are identified by the token below.

pipeline stamp: htk31_f769b577b3028a4e9958e5bb8d1259a

## Changelog — AgriPulse Gateway v3.8.0

Renamed setting: `GATEWAY_AUTH_PIN` is now `FLEET_UPLINK_TOKEN`. The old name implied a short numeric code, but the value is a full bearer credential used by the telemetry uplink to the Harrowfield fleet service. All tractor-mounted units running firmware 3.8+ read the new name only; 3.7 units fall back to the legacy key until Q3 decommissioning. Security note: rotation cadence is unchanged at 90 days. Deployment env files must define the new variable on the line immediately following this entry.

env line for kageg-fajof: COURIER_KEY5=93d14